    Two uniform strings A and B made of steel are made to vibrate under the same tension. if the first overtone of A is equal to the second overtone of B and if the radius of A is twice that of B, the ratio of the lengths of the strings is [EAMCET 2003]

    A)             1: 2                                          

    B)            1 : 3

    C)            1 : 4                                          

    D)            1 : 6

    Correct Answer: B

    Solution :

                         First overtone of string\[A\]= Second overtone of string B.                    \[\Rightarrow \] Second harmonic of \[A\] = Third harmonic of B                    \[\Rightarrow \] \[{{n}_{2}}={{n}_{3}}\]\[\Rightarrow \] \[{{\left[ 2({{n}_{1}}) \right]}_{A}}={{\left[ 3({{n}_{1}}) \right]}_{B}}\] (\[\because \] \[{{n}_{1}}=\frac{1}{2l}\sqrt{\frac{T}{\pi {{r}^{2}}\rho }}\])                    Þ\[2\,\left[ \frac{1}{2{{l}_{A}}{{r}_{A}}}\sqrt{\frac{T}{\pi \rho }} \right]=3\,\left[ \frac{1}{2{{l}_{B}}{{r}_{B}}}\sqrt{\frac{T}{\pi \rho }} \right]\]                    \[\frac{{{l}_{A}}}{{{l}_{B}}}=\frac{2}{3}\frac{{{r}_{B}}}{{{r}_{A}}}\Rightarrow \frac{{{l}_{A}}}{{{l}_{B}}}=\frac{2}{3}\times \frac{{{r}_{B}}}{(2{{r}_{B}})}=\frac{1}{3}\]
